TU Seth Green Fly Tying Course – Introduction to Fly Tying

Course Closed Until Next Season

This course is intended to teach a novice or beginner the art of fly tying, how to tie well proportioned and well constructed fishing flies for trout fishing. The course consist of seven
2-hour teaching sessions and one 2-hour review session. During the review session a student may ask for a demonstration of a technique not covered during the teaching sessions.

Topics to be covered are:
How to select the proper fish hook for most flies.
The proper use of the appropriate tools used in fly tying.
Material selection and handling for and during fly tying
The processes used to tie well proportioned, well constructed flies.

Students will tie their own flies during the class. Materials for tying the flies taught in will be provided for THE FIRST CLASS ONLY. Students will provide their own tools, as well as materials for remaining classes. The instructor will demonstrate each fly and provide assistance for the students while they are tying the same fly in class.

Certain tools are required for the course and they can be found at your local fly shops or at any Gander Mountain location.

Here is a list of the tools needed for fly tying:
-
Fly Tying Vise
- Bobbin
- Bobbin Threader
- Dubbing Needle
- Hackle Pliers
- Scissors Medium
- 6/0 Black Thread
